Player wont take damage

Hey so for some reason my player wont take damage when he collides with an enemy can someone help me? the error I get is `NullReferenceException: Object reference not set to an instance of an object StoneGolemController.OnCollisionEnter (UnityEngine.Collision collision) (at Assets/Scripts/Enemies/StoneGolem/StoneGolemController.cs:51)

Here is my collide part

 public void OnCollisionEnter(Collision collision)
     {
         if (collision.transform.tag == "Player")
         {
             attackDamage = Random.Range(minAttackDamage, maxAttackDamage);
             critDamage = attackDamage * 3;
             float randValue = Random.value;
 
             if (randValue < critChance)
             {
                 //Crit attack
                 Debug.Log("Crit attack " + critDamage);
                 PlayerController pHealth = collision.collider.GetComponent<PlayerController>();
                 pHealth.TakeDamagePlayer(critDamage);
             }
             else 
             {
                 //Normal attack
                 Debug.Log("Normal attack " + attackDamage);
                 PlayerController pHealth = collision.collider.GetComponent<PlayerController>();
                 pHealth.TakeDamagePlayer(attackDamage);
             }
         }
     }

and here is the player takedamage part

 public void TakeDamagePlayer(int damage)
     {
         currentHealth -= damage;
 
         healthBar.SetHealth(currentHealth);
     }
